Medroxalol hydrochloride
Medroxalol hydrochloride is a dual alpha- and beta-adrenergic receptor antagonist used in hypertension research. It is applied in pharmacological studies to investigate adrenergic blockade mechanisms in both in vitro receptor binding assays and in vivo animal models of cardiovascular function.
